Massage Therapy in Indiana

Explore Indiana massage licensing requirements, professional organizations, insurance considerations, continuing education, workforce data, and official resources, with dated official sources and scheduled review.

Insurance considerations

Verified

Legal requirement finding

Indiana requires professional-liability insurance of at least $2,000,000 per claim and $6,000,000 aggregate. This does not resolve employers, establishments, leases, schools, events, contracts, or local requirements.

A reviewed authority identifies a legal insurance requirement. General information only—not legal, financial, or coverage advice.

Insurance sources

Professional risk context

Compare covered modalities, exclusions, defense costs, policy form, prior-acts treatment, occurrence territory, and reporting duties.

General liability addresses premises and other third-party risks that may be distinct from professional services.

  • A narrow state-law finding is not a recommendation to practice uninsured.
  • Confirm employer, contract, establishment, landlord, event, and local requirements independently.

Questions for an insurer

  • Which modalities, populations, and locations are covered?
  • Are defense costs inside or outside policy limits?
  • What incident-reporting deadlines and exclusions apply?

Workforce data

Indiana workforce outlook

Bounded

BLS May 2023 OEWS estimated 1,020 wage-and-salary massage therapist jobs in Indiana, with a median hourly wage of $28.03. These are estimates, not license or practitioner counts.
